Multidimensional Mapping and Indexing of XML

We propose a multidimensional approach to store XML data in relational database systems. In contrast to other efforts we suggest a solution to the problem using established database technology. We present a multidimensional mapping scheme for XML and also thoroughly study the impact of established and commercially available multidimensional index structures (compound B-Trees and UB-Trees) on the performance of the mapping scheme. In addition, we compare our multidimensional mapping to other known mapping schemes. While studying the performance we have identified projection and selection to be fundamental parts of a typical query on XML documents. Our measurements show that projection and selection are orthogonal and require special multidimensional index support to be processed efficiently.